Understanding Galvanized Products and Their Importance

Galvanized products are steel components coated with zinc through the galvanizing process. This zinc layer acts as a shield, preventing the steel from coming into direct contact with the external elements that cause corrosion.

While ordinary coatings offer only surface protection, hot-dip galvanised steel provides long-term protection because the zinc forms a bond with the steel surface; even when some surface damage occurs, the zinc still protects the exposed area through sacrificial protection.

It means that galvanized solutions are suitable for industries in which durability, safety, and a low level of maintenance are important factors.

Benefits of Hot Dip Galvanizing for Steel Protection

1. Superior Corrosion Resistance

The main benefit of hot-dip galvanizing is that it protects steel from corrosion; the zinc coating provides reliable protection against moisture, rain, chemicals, and atmospheric conditions.

As a result, galvanized steel is suitable for use outdoors, for example, on highways, in power infrastructure, in industrial plants, and in construction projects.

2. Long Service Life

Hot-dip galvanised parts are designed to perform satisfactorily for many years with minimal maintenance; the strong metallurgical bond between zinc and steel ensures the coating stays attached even under harsh conditions.

It lowers replacement costs and helps industries get more lifecycle value from their investments.

3. Reduced Maintenance Requirements

Routine painting and surface treatments can increase operating costs, while galvanised steel needs less frequent maintenance than traditional protective coatings.

When accessibility is a problem in infrastructure projects, choosing galvanised solutions can greatly reduce future maintenance needs.

4. Cost-Effective Protection

Even though galvanizing involves an initial outlay, it does offer excellent long-term value since its extended lifespan and lower need for repairs make it a practical option for a number of industrial applications.

Applications of Hot-Dip Galvanized Products

Galvanized steel is used in many industries because of its strength and durability.

  1. Cable Trays and Industrial Electrical Systems

Cable trays are important components used in power plants, manufacturing facilities, and commercial buildings, and their performance may be affected by exposure to humidity and industrial environments.

Hot-dip galvanized cable trays offer extra corrosion protection and help keep the cable management system reliable over long-term operations.

  1. Crash Barriers for Road Safety

Materials used in road safety infrastructure must withstand outdoor conditions. Galvanized crash barriers are commonly used on highways and roads since they provide durability, strength, and resistance to weather exposure.

The zinc coating prolongs the life of safety barriers while reducing maintenance needs.

  1. Substation Structures and Power Infrastructure

Power transmission and distribution systems need sturdy, reliable structures, and substations built with galvanised steel resist corrosion and maintain consistent performance in harsh environments.

Galvanizing helps to improve the reliability of both electrical systems and support structures.

  1. Construction and Industrial Applications

Galvanized steel is frequently used in warehouses, fabrication projects, industrial plants, and structural frameworks since its durability means that it is appropriate for use in situations where long-term performance is needed.

FAQs

1. What are galvanized products?

Galvanized products are steel components coated with zinc to protect them from corrosion. The zinc layer creates a durable protective barrier that improves steel lifespan and makes these products suitable for infrastructure, industrial, and construction applications.

2. Why is hot-dip galvanizing used for steel?

Hot-dip galvanizing is used because it provides long-lasting corrosion protection. The zinc coating bonds strongly with steel and protects it from moisture, weather, and environmental damage with minimal maintenance.

3. Where are galvanized products commonly used?

Galvanized products are used in power infrastructure, construction projects, highways, industrial plants, cable management systems, and safety structures. Their durability makes them suitable for applications requiring reliable performance in challenging environments.

4. How long do galvanized steel products last?

The lifespan of galvanized steel depends on environmental conditions and coating thickness. However, properly galvanized steel can provide decades of corrosion protection, reducing replacement and maintenance requirements for many applications.
